Blog posts
Blog posts, which are among many forms of content marketing, is a great way establish relationships with your customers and to convert them into customers. AdEspresso, for example, maintains a consistently updated blog and publishes high-quality content that generates significant traffic. While blogging is an accessible form of content marketing, there are pitfalls. For example, you should avoid the temptation to post frequently, but make sure to update your best-performing posts on a regular basis.

Video
There are many different types of video marketing you can use, whether you are in the market to find a new product for your business or just looking for creative ways you can promote your brand. Tutorials, for example, are a great way to showcase how to use a product. These videos can be used to help customers retain them and increase sales. Animations on the other side can be a powerful way to explain complex subjects and ideas to your audience. Animations and digital animations offer the added benefit of being informative and entertaining.

What is the primary goal of content marketing?
Content marketing provides valuable and relevant information to customers. This can be done via email campaigns, blog posts, white papers, and other channels. The key is to deliver value to your audience.

How to make a video for content-marketing?
Videos for content marketing are one of most powerful ways to communicate your message with your audience. By sharing stories they value, you can reach your target audience. How do you make them stand apart from the rest? Here are some tips for creating videos that get noticed!
-
When creating a video, it's important to realize that no one size fits all. You need to make sure your video speaks directly to your audience. If the message you are trying to communicate isn't applicable to everyone, why would they watch it?
